The Business Systems Analyst (BSA) is responsible for analyzing data and defining requirements for technology solutions in projects or products. The role requires taking an unstructured business problem and produce and present clear, fact-based recommendations to the business partners, and ease their transition towards implementation. The recommendation could include an organizational structure, a people training, a process change, and modifications to business rules or implementation of new technology, or a combination of all.
WORK YOU’LL DO
Requirement Analysis: Gather, analyze, and document business and technical requirements related to payment processing, ensuring alignment with industry standards such as ISO 20022, SWIFT CBPR+ , Lynx, Fedwire etc.
Payments Lifecycle Expertise: Provide insights into end-to-end payment processing, covering origination, processing, clearing, settlement, and reconciliation across different payment rails.
Payments Platform Knowledge: Work with a modern payments platforms assisting in configuration, integration, and enhancements.
Stakeholder Management: Collaborate with business teams, technology teams and vendors to ensure smooth implementation of the payment solutions.
Data Mapping & Messaging Standards: Understand payment message formats, including MX, MT, and APIs, and assist in data mapping for seamless system integration.
Regulatory Compliance: Ensure payment processes adhere to regulatory requirements, including ISO 20022, Fintrac and central bank regulations.
Testing & Implementation Support: Review test cases, validate payment flows, and support SIT/ UAT (User Acceptance Testing) and post-implementation validation.
Process Improvement: Identify opportunities to optimize and automate payment processes to enhance efficiency and reduce operational risk.
Qualifications
Basic Qualifications:
5-7 years of experience with the end-to-end payments lifecycle , covering origination, processing, clearing, settlement, and reconciliation across different payment rails.
Experience of working with modern payments platforms like Volante, FIS , Fiserv EPP and Finastra GPP, assisting in configuration, integration, and enhancements.
Strong knowledge of ISO 20022, in-depth understanding of MT/MX message structures, and experience in cross-border and wire payments like CBPR+, LYNX , FEDWIRE payment formats.
